Please help us welcome Mrs. Keely Green to Snyder High School, where she will teach Precalculus and Dual Credit Math!
Mrs. Green brings a strong background in math instruction, including experience with Grand Prairie ISD, Tarrant County College, Snyder ISD, Western Texas College, and Ira ISD.
She earned her bachelorโs degree from the University of Texas at Arlington in 2002 and her masterโs degree from Texas Tech University in 2017.
Mrs. Green was born in Dallas, grew up in West Texas, and later returned to Snyder. This year is especially meaningful because her youngest child will be a freshman at Snyder High School, giving her the chance to spend the next four years on the same campus while continuing to support Snyder Tigers.
Her โwhyโ says it best:
โMath is in my DNA. I want to share my knowledge and understanding and be part of young peopleโs learning.โ
Outside of school, Mrs. Green enjoys cross-stitching and working out.
Welcome to Snyder High School, Mrs. Green!

Please help us welcome Mrs. Lydia Fisk to Snyder Primary School as our school nurse!
Mrs. Fisk is a lifelong Snyder resident and a proud Snyder ISD parent. She is honored to give back to the district that has played such an important role in her familyโs life.
She earned her Associateโs Degree from New Mexico State University Carlsbad and brings 31 years of experience as a registered nurse. Throughout her career, she has provided compassionate care and support to others, building strong clinical skills, patience, empathy, and a heart for service.
Her โwhyโ is simple: caring for people.
โNursing has provided me with the opportunity to make a positive difference in the lives of others, offer comfort during difficult times, and serve my community in a meaningful way.โ
Outside of work, Mrs. Fisk enjoys attending church, Bible study, and spending time with her family.
We are grateful to have Mrs. Fisk caring for our youngest Tigers at Snyder Primary School!

๐๐ Did you know? One of Snyder ISDโs goals is to help students graduate with more than a diploma.
Through our Career & Technical Education programs, students have opportunities to earn industry-based certifications, gain real-world experience, explore potential career paths, and develop skills that will serve them long after graduation. Whether students choose college, technical training, military service, or the workforce, these experiences help prepare them for what comes next.
Congratulations to these Snyder High School seniors who have earned their Texas Educational Aide I Certification while still in high school:

To earn this credential, students completed a rigorous process that included advanced Education & Training coursework, field-based internship experiences working alongside students and mentor teachers, and meeting certification requirements established by the Texas Education Agency.
This certification recognizes students who have gained valuable classroom experience while developing skills in teaching, child development, communication, leadership, and professionalism.
We are proud of these nine seniors for taking this important step toward their future and for the positive impact they have already made in our schools. Their work reflects the purpose of Career & Technical Education: helping students discover their passions, build meaningful skills, and leave high school prepared for whatโs next.
